Charlie Kimball will be back behind the wheel of the #23 Carlin Racing Chevy at the Bommarito Automotive Group 500 at World Wide Technology Raceway at Gateway, thanks to funding from new sponsor ripKurrent.
Kimball, who's three prior starts have been funded by Tresibia, welcomed the new sponsor to the team.
"After meeting the ripKurrent group last year and seeing their passion for the NTT IndyCar Series with its competitive racing and the Indianapolis Motor Speedway, it is really exciting to carry their name on the No. 23 ripKurrent Carlin Chevrolet at the Bommarito Automotive Group 500 at World Wide Technology Raceway at Gateway," said Kimball.
"Racing under the lights is what the NTT IndyCar Series is all about and we will be aiming for a great result for ripKurrent, Carlin and Team Chevy!"
Carlin Racing team director Trevor Carlin intended to field three cars full-time in 2019, however with funding cuts, the team was forced to run one full-time car and two part-time cars. Carlin hopes that with a successful debut, it could lead to ripKurrent to add more races for 2020 and beyond.
"We’re really looking forward to being a part of ripKurrent’s debut into the NTT IndyCar Series and having Charlie back in the No. 23 for the Bommarito Automotive Group 500. ripKurrent is a new, innovative company, which is exactly the type of partner the series needs right now," added Team Principal Trevor Carlin.
"We’re very excited to have Charlie back in the car at Gateway also. He brings so much experience and knowledge to the team and he’s shown how strong he is on the ovals, so hopefully we can get ripKurrent a good result at their first race."
Kimball is competing in his ninth season in the NTT IndyCar Series. He scored his first NTT IndyCar Series win in 2013 at Mid-Ohio Sports Car Course and his first pole in 2017 at Texas Motor Speedway. Kimball has 138 Indy car starts, producing one win, one pole, 14 top-five finishes, 55 top-10 finishes, and 163 laps led.
